7

Python 2.7.3によると、ドキュメントmultiprocessing.Eventはの「クローン」ですthreading.Event。ただし、次のコードを使用すると、次のようになります。

from multiprocessing import Event
test = Event()
test.set()
test.isSet()

ただし、次のエラーが発生します。

AttributeError: 'Event' Object has no attribute 'isSet'

何が得られますか?マルチプロセッシングイベントに、設定されているかどうかを確認するメソッドがないのはなぜですか?

編集:is_setがマルチプロセッシングイベントクラス内にあることが判明しました...それでもドキュメントは嘘をついています

4

1 に答える 1

11

Eventクラスのインスタンスにはis_setメソッドがあります。この人を試してください:

test.is_set()

is_setのドキュメント

于 2013-02-05T17:46:13.663 に答える